Problem

Existing load measurement technologies face challenges in achieving high sensitivity and spatial resolution simultaneously, particularly in detecting small loads and maintaining compatibility across different load ranges.

Innovation Solution

A light emitting structure incorporating a mechanoluminescent material with a contact portion having a predetermined length and a discontinuous contact surface, allowing for increased stress concentration and high-intensity light emission in response to applied loads.

AI summary

A light emitting structure emits light in response to a load applied to an object from a load object. In the light emitting structure are formed contacting portions which are provided on a supporting surface of the object, and which have a predetermined length from the surface of the supporting surface in a direction perpendicular to the surface of the object, wherein a stress-luminescent material is included in at least a portion of the supporting surface and the surface of the contacting portions.
